  • Family Records:
    we sometimes get enquiries relating to records of births marriages and deaths, but unfortunately we do not hold this information.  There are many sources of information available on the internet, one of the following may help

    • Chippenham Museum & Heritage Centre hold archives appertaining to many aspects of life in Chippenham and more pertinently some Grave Records from St Paul’s Churchyard detailing the grave number, family name, list of persons buried in the grave, date of death and address where the burial was from. Along with transcriptions of baptisms, marriages and burials between 1855 – 1909.
    • Wiltshire and Swindon History Centre holds all the historic records of births marriages and deaths for the parish – from 1855 onwards when the church was built and the parish created. They also have the vast majority of historic records for the whole of Wiltshire.
